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will assess the damage and create a customized plan to address your specific situation. This includes identifying the source of the water damage, determining the extent of the damage, and selecting the best course of action. We’ll work closely with you to ensure you understand the plan and are comfortable with the process.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Next, our team will use heavy-duty pumps to extract the water from the affected area. We’ll also use industrial-grade wet vacuums to remove any remaining water and moisture.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ring the area is safe to work in.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ers to dry the area quickly and efficiently. We’ll also use desiccant dehumidifiers to remove any remaining moisture and humidity from the air.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ring the area is safe and healthy.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

After the area has been dried, our team will cl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ent any potential health hazards. We’ll use EPA-registered cleaning products and industrial-grade sanitizers to ensure the area is safe and healthy.

Step 5: Restoration and Repair

Finally, our team will restore and repair any damaged areas, including drywall, flooring, and cabinetry. We’ll work closely with you to ensure the area is restored to its original state, and we’ll use matching materials to ensure a seamless finish.

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ration Cost in Gold Canyon, AZ

The cost of laundry room water damage restoration in Gold Canyon, AZ can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ions in your area. Here are some estimated costs to exp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of the affected area, severity of the damage, and local conditions.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of the affected area, severity of the damage, and local conditions.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area, severity of the damage, and local conditions.
Restoration and Repair $1,000 – $5,000 Size of the affected area, severity of the damage, and local conditions.
